I purchased some billet one inch risers for my B1100 of the inter web some time back, they are nicely machined but came sans any mounting bolts.   The local hardware store doesn't carry Allen head button bolts, neither does Farm and Fleet, so I didn't know where to turn.   I knew I could get them from McMaster Carr, but I don't have an account and I really only needed 6pc.

Someone here on this board mentioned a company called MrMetric.com, I looked them up and it was a piece of cake!  I quickly found exactly what I needed on their web site  SS A2 8 x 55 mm button head bolts for just over a dollar each, with no min order, and flat $6 shipping!  So for just over $13 I got 6 high quality metric bolts shipped to my door via USPS 2day mail.  I know it's a small thing, but every thing about the way they do business seems competent, professional and they gave me the feeling they appreciated my business.
